Diagnostic Tools and Their Benefits
  • Digital X-rays: Compared to traditional film X-rays, digital radiography offers several advantages. It significantly reduces radiation exposure to the patient, provides immediate image display, and allows for enhanced image manipulation for better diagnostic clarity. This means your dentist can detect issues like cavities or bone loss more effectively.
  • Intraoral Cameras: These small cameras allow your dentist to show you a magnified view of your teeth and gums on a screen. This visual aid can be incredibly helpful in understanding your oral health condition and the proposed treatment plan. You can see what the dentist sees, fostering a sense of partnership in your care.
  • 3D Imaging (CBCT): For more complex cases, such as implant planning or diagnosing intricate root canal issues,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T) offers a three-dimensional view of your oral structures. This level of detail is invaluable for precise diagnosis and treatment planning.

Restorative Dentistry: Repairing and Rebuilding

When teeth have been damaged by decay, injury, or wear, restorative dentistry plays a crucial role in bringing them back to full function and appearance.

Addressing Cavities and Tooth Decay
  • Dental Fillings: For cavities, composite resin (tooth-colored) fillings are commonly used. These fillings are aesthetically pleasing and can be bonded directly to the tooth for a strong and durable repair.
  • Inlays and Onlays: For more extensive tooth damage, inlays and onlays made of porcelain or composite material may be recommended. These are fabricated in a dental lab and then bonded to the tooth, offering a more robust restoration than a standard filling.
Crowns, Bridges, and Root Canals
  • Dental Crowns: A crown acts as a cap for a damaged tooth, restoring its shape, size, strength, and appearance. They are often used after a root canal or on teeth that are severely decayed or fractured.
  • Dental Bridges: If you are missing one or more teeth, a dental bridge can be used to replace them. A bridge consists of one or more artificial teeth anchored to the natural teeth on either side of the gap.
  • Root Canal Therapy: This procedure is performed when the pulp (the soft tissue inside the tooth) becomes inflamed or infected. The infected pulp is removed, the inside of the tooth is cleaned and disinfected, and then filled and sealed. While often perceived negatively, modern root canal therapy, when performed by gentle dentists, can be a comfortable and effective way to save a tooth.

Cosmetic Dentistry: Enhancing Your Smile

For those seeking to improve the aesthetics of their smile, cosmetic dentistry offers a range of options to address imperfections and create a more confident appearance.

Teeth Whitening and Veneers
  • Professional Teeth Whitening: This can significantly brighten your smile by removing stains and discoloration from your teeth. Gentle Dentist Cooley Station likely offers in-office treatments or custom-made take-home kits for your convenience.
  • Dental Veneers: Veneers are thin, custom-made shells of porcelain or composite resin that are bonded to the front surface of your teeth. They can effectively correct issues like chipped teeth, stained teeth, misaligned teeth, and irregularly shaped teeth.
Smile Makeovers and Bonding
  • Smile Makeovers: For individuals with multiple aesthetic concerns, a smile makeover involves a comprehensive plan that combines various cosmetic dental procedures to achieve your desired results.
  • Dental Bonding: This involves applying a tooth-colored composite resin material to repair minor chips, cracks, or discoloration on your teeth. It’s a more conservative approach compared to veneers and can often be completed in a single visit.
